
Will there be a second season of ‘Something Very Bad Is Going to Happen’?
Netflix has left netizens shaken with its latest horror-mystery thriller, Something Very Bad Is Going to Happen, from creator Haley Z Boston, sparking fears about commitment and marriages they didn’t know existed in the first place.
The Netflix series, executive-produced by the Duffer Brothers, follows Rachel’s growing dread about commitment and the idea of a soulmate in the lead-up to her wedding with Nicky, featuring a harrowing plot twist and culminating in a bloody finale. While we know how the series unfolds, what’s next for Something Very Bad Is Going to Happen? Is the show one and done?
In a recent conversation with ScreenRant, Boston addressed the possibility of a second season of Something Very Bad Is Going to Happen, reasoning that since it was birthed as a limited series, “it is kind of a full story.” “But I think there’s a world where it’s a totally different, very bad thing. I’d have to find another existential fear to explore,” she continued.
In essence, even though Rachel and Nicky’s story may be complete, Boston wouldn’t mind a new storyline, which “has got to be worse” for the characters since “you got to elevate it every time.”
Boston also spoke to Deadline separately about whether she plans to make it an “ongoing series,” saying, “I mean, it could be. At one point, I thought, what if it’s Jude’s wedding in however many years, and Rachel’s still Rachel because she’s immortal? Or Nicky’s next wedding, which she has to come with witness.”
Although that could make many hopeful, Boston ensured to clarify that she does believe it is a “complete story in and of itself, as well.” “So, it could go on, and it just be what it is,” she added.
As of now, Netflix hasn’t officially renewed Something Very Bad Is Going to Happen for a second season, nor has it cancelled the show after the first.
The “limited series” tag might worry fans, and we understand why. However, quite a few shows on Netflix conceived as miniseries have evolved into multiple seasons, such as the Emmy-winning anthology series, BEEF, whose second instalment is due this April.
Having said that, with Boston giving out mixed signals about the possibility, it still feels too early to say what the future could look like for Something Very Bad Is Going to Happen. So, until Netflix gives the green signal, we might have to wait a bit longer.
